b. Pressure
Explanation:
Pressure is a physical effect that can change the boiling point of a substance.
Pressure is the force per unit area on a body.
- A substance will boil when the vapor pressure of its heated molecules is greater than the atmospheric pressure.
- The higher the atmospheric pressure, the higher the temperature and energy required to boil a substance.
- At high altitude, the atmospheric pressure is low and the boiling point of substances is lower.
